Fátima Fernández is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Molecular Biology and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Fátima Fernández has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 501 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 7 papers in Molecular Biology and 4 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Fátima Fernández’s work include Plasmonic and Surface Plasmon Research (8 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(6 papers) and Photonic and Optical Devices (4 papers). Fátima Fernández is often cited by papers focused on Plasmonic and Surface Plasmon Research (8 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(6 papers) and Photonic and Optical Devices (4 papers). Fátima Fernández collaborates with scholars based in Spain and Czechia. Fátima Fernández's co-authors include Francisco Sánchez‐Baeza, M.‐Pilar Marco, Kateřina Hegnerová, Jiřı́ Homola, Marek Piliarik, Daniel G. Pinacho, Javier Adrián, Aaron C. Asensio, Edurne Tellechea and José F. Morán and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ry, Food Chemistry and Optics Letters.
